Physical properties

Hardness: 6.5-7 on Mohs scale; Color: Soft purple, lavender, lilac, or pale violet; Luster: Waxy to vitreous; Crystal structure: Trigonal (microcrystalline/cryptocrystalline quartz); Cleavage: None; Specific gravity: 2.58-2.64.

Formation & geological history

Formed via secondary precipitation of silica from low-temperature hydrothermal fluids or percolating groundwater in cavities, fractures, and vesicles of volcanic rocks or sedimentary formations.

Uses & applications

Popular for lapidary work, cabochons, carved ornaments, wire-wrapped jewelry, and polished pocket stones for crystal collectors.

Geological facts

Chalcedony is composed of microscopic intergrowths of quartz and moganite. Its soft lavender to violet coloration is often attributed to trace amounts of iron or manganese impurities or optical scattering.

Field identification & locations

Identified by its microcrystalline texture, soft translucent purple appearance, shell-like (conchoidal) fracture, and lack of visible individual crystal faces. Found in Brazil, Madagascar, Namibia, Turkey, and the USA (e.g., Oregon, California).
